Compare Hospital Prices Across the United States

This page shows the cost variations for procedure code across different hospitals in the United States. The data is compiled from hospital chargemaster files, which list the standard charges for medical procedures and services.

Why do prices vary? Hospital pricing can differ significantly based on location, facility type, and local market conditions. Use this data to understand price ranges and compare costs across states and hospitals.

ℹ️ About This Data

The prices shown are from hospital chargemaster files, which represent the list prices hospitals charge before insurance negotiations or discounts. Your actual cost may be different depending on your insurance coverage, deductibles, and negotiated rates. Always check with your insurance provider and hospital for accurate cost estimates.
